**Ticket #4412 — GraphWeave vault locked again**

Hey folks, the credentials vault for GraphWeave (our dependency graph visualizer) locked itself after three failed syncs overnight. Until Marisol rotates the service token, support can unlock it manually from the admin panel. Don't share this outside the team, obviously. The recovery passphrase you'll need is right below.

vault phrase of bagaf-kajeg = jorath-feniel-briir-siliel-ralix

Ticket: Staging env misconfigured for Siftgate bloom filter

The bloom layer in front of the Pellet KV store is rejecting all lookups in staging because the env file was copied from the dev template without credentials. False-positive tuning values are fine; only the auth line is missing. To unblock the weekly demo, the Pellet admission secret must be set on the following line.

env line for yaguf-fajop: LEDGER_TOKEN13=fb08984397349

**Vendor note: Inkmill markdown pipeline**

Rendering for Parchway docs is outsourced to Inkmill under an annual contract, renewing each March. They handle sanitization and PDF export; we own the upload queue. SLA: 4-hour response on rendering failures. Escalate only after two failed retries. Their support desk is reachable at the address below.

billing contact of hahaf-baguf = zorael.tammir.jorius@sivrelhq.internal